Transaction e85768622dca00905a2a064ec518215d8f488033090eef487cb4930a22ed85dd
1 Input
1 Output
-
e85768622dca00905a2a064ec518215d8f488033090eef487cb4930a22ed85dd:0
- value
- 134642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c82f8ec45c3d402a3b081e922970ee9447d3113b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KFV7jT3ELZZVzTzQPpLfSEZPuMJb2q2aE